Chapter 1417 The Beginning of a Nightmare
Mrs. Wanner hesitated, not wanting to finish her sentence and dismissing the thought immediately. "I can't bring myself to say those depressing words. I'm just glad that you're safe now. But why did you only come back today? Do you know..."
Deirdre's eyes looked sad, prompting Mrs. Wanner to remain silent with a complicated and distressed expression.
Mrs. Wanner quickly changed the subject. "Ms. McKinnon, your baby bump is already quite big."
Deirdre nodded and hesitantly asked, "Did Brendan mention when he'll be back today?"
Mrs. Wanner stiffened. "Um... Mr. Brighthall has some business to attend to today. I'm not sure exactly when he'll be back. He might be busy, so he may not return tonight..."
Gripping her palms, Deirdre said, "Can I go inside and wait, then?"
"Of course!" Mrs. Wanner nodded hastily, feeling sorry for her, and led Deirdre inside. She served tea and water and even put a jacket on Deirdre as if afraid she might feel cold.
